How much do coffee man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for coffee manager in Boca Raton, FL is $48,365.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$32,381.00 and $61,905.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are coffee managers?

Coffee managers oversee the daily operations of coffee shops or cafes, ensuring quality service, product consistency, and customer satisfaction. Their responsibilities include managing staff, handling inventory, setting schedules, and maintaining facility standards. They may also be involved in hiring, training, and developing strategies to increase sales and profitability. A coffee manager often works closely with baristas and other team members to create a positive work environment and uphold the business's brand and quality standards.

What is the difference between Coffee Manager vs Barista?

AspectCoffee ManagerBarista
CredentialsExperience in management, possibly certifications in hospitality or food serviceTypically no formal certifications required, on-the-job training common
Work EnvironmentOversees entire coffee shop operations, manages staff, handles inventoryPrepares coffee and beverages, interacts directly with customers
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in coffee shop chains, cafes, hospitality industryCommon in cafes, coffee shops, specialty coffee outlets

The main difference between a Coffee Manager and a Barista lies in their responsibilities and experience. A Coffee Manager oversees daily operations, manages staff, and handles administrative tasks, often requiring management experience. A Barista focuses on preparing beverages and providing customer service. Both roles are essential in coffee establishments, but they differ significantly in scope and required credentials.

What are some common challenges a Coffee Manager faces in maintaining product quality and consistency across shifts?

A Coffee Manager often encounters challenges in ensuring that drinks and products consistently meet brand standards, especially when managing a team with varying levels of experience. This requires continuous staff training, regular quality checks, and clear communication of expectations. Additionally, managing inventory to prevent shortages or waste, and adapting to customer feedback, are crucial to maintaining high-quality service. By fostering a collaborative environment and implementing standardized procedures, Coffee Managers can help their teams deliver a consistently excellent customer experience.
